About me
I am an experienced LMFT who is dedicated assisting individuals with anxiety, depression, life changes and goal attainment
I know what it's like being scared to seek help. I know that asking for help can sometimes feel like things are failing and I caused them. I also know how nervous I felt when I looked for assistance and wanting to begin therapy, scared with questions like, will I be judged? Will they keep my confidence? Can I trust them? I knew that when seeking therapy and looking for help all I wanted was for things to be better, get better, live healthier and be accepted. Therapy is scary, it can bring up issues that may be more frightening than you would like to cope with. Therapy is also helpful, healthy and the best part is, you're not alone.
I have numerous years of skill working with individuals wanting to accomplish goals. Tracking the goals. Finding and praising small, incremental gains along the way. I have been effectively working with individuals through motivational interviewing, CBT and DBT. I have experience in co-occurring substance and mental health along with family/couple therapy.
